The Enduring Significance of Macro Lenses

For the casual observer, the introduction of another ~100mm f/2.8 macro lens might appear to be a routine product cycle. The market has indeed seen a proliferation of such lenses, often featuring similar focal lengths, wide f/2.8 apertures, and built-in image stabilization. However, discerning photographers understand that macro lenses are a unique category, often representing the pinnacle of optical engineering within a manufacturer’s lineup. Historically, macro lenses are celebrated for their extraordinary sharpness, precise autofocus, and robust construction. Their design prioritizes resolving intricate details at extremely close focusing distances, a demanding task that requires meticulous optical correction. While often associated with capturing hyper-detailed images of insects, flowers, or eyeballs, their inherent qualities—exceptional resolving power, minimal distortion, and often beautiful bokeh—make them highly versatile tools for a variety of photographic disciplines, including portraiture, product photography, and fine art. The perceived trade-off has traditionally been in autofocus speed, a characteristic often sacrificed for accuracy in close-up scenarios.
Sony’s Groundbreaking Innovations: What Sets the FE 100mm f/2.8 Macro GM Apart

The Sony FE 100mm f/2.8 Macro GM distinguishes itself through several key technological advancements that elevate it beyond its competitors. At first glance, it shares a familiar form factor, yet its internal architecture and performance metrics are engineered for superior results.
One of the most striking features is its 1.4x magnification ratio, surpassing the industry-standard 1:1 (or 1x) magnification offered by many contemporary macro lenses. The 1:1 ratio means that the subject is projected onto the camera sensor at its real-life size. A 1.4x magnification, therefore, allows the subject to be reproduced 1.4 times larger on the sensor, revealing even finer details and providing a more immersive close-up experience without the need for additional extension tubes or close-up filters. This increased magnification directly translates to capturing more intricate textures and subtle nuances, which is invaluable for scientific, artistic, and commercial macro applications.

The optical prowess of the lens is underpinned by its sophisticated 17-element, 13-group optical design. While specific element types (such as aspherical, ED, or Super ED glass) are typically detailed in Sony’s G Master lenses to combat chromatic aberration, spherical aberration, and distortion, the sheer complexity of this configuration points to a design meticulously optimized for extreme sharpness and contrast across the entire frame, from the center to the periphery, even at wide apertures. Furthermore, the inclusion of Nano AR coating is critical. This advanced anti-reflective coating effectively suppresses flares and ghosting, common issues in complex lighting conditions, ensuring superior clarity and contrast in images, particularly when shooting into bright light sources or with intricate subjects that reflect light in unpredictable ways. This level of optical refinement is a hallmark of the G Master series, promising exceptional image fidelity.
Perhaps the most revolutionary aspect of the Sony FE 100mm f/2.8 Macro GM is its autofocus system. Sony has equipped this lens with four XD (extreme dynamic) linear motors, a significant departure from the slower, more traditional autofocus mechanisms often found in macro lenses. XD linear motors are renowned for their high thrust, speed, and precision, delivering incredibly fast and accurate focusing performance. This addresses the long-standing compromise in macro lens design, where accuracy was prioritized over speed. With the FE 100mm f/2.8 Macro GM, photographers can now achieve rapid and reliable autofocus, even on moving subjects, a capability that dramatically expands the creative possibilities for dynamic macro photography, such as capturing fast-moving insects or fleeting moments in nature. This speed also makes the lens highly adaptable for non-macro uses, such as portraiture or event photography, where quick and precise focusing is paramount.

Unlocking Further Potential: Teleconverter Compatibility
A feature that has particularly excited professional photographers is the lens’s compatibility with the Sony FE 2.0x teleconverter. When paired, this teleconverter effectively doubles the focal length of the lens to 200mm and, crucially, amplifies the magnification level to an astounding 2.8x. This capability is a game-changer for specialized macro work, especially in fields like beauty macro photography, where photographers often struggle to achieve sufficient magnification while maintaining an appropriate working distance to avoid obstructing light or casting shadows. The increased focal length and magnification allow photographers to capture incredibly tight, detailed shots from a greater distance, offering enhanced creative control and practical convenience. This combination pushes the lens into a realm of super-macro photography typically reserved for highly specialized and often more cumbersome setups.

The lens also boasts a robust five-stop image stabilization system, an essential feature for handheld macro shooting where even the slightest camera movement can lead to blur due to the extreme magnifications involved. This stabilization, combined with the fast autofocus, makes the FE 100mm f/2.8 Macro GM an exceptionally versatile and user-friendly tool, even in challenging field conditions. Its minimum focusing distance of 0.26m further complements its macro capabilities, allowing photographers to get exceptionally close to their subjects.
Initial Field Impressions: A Benchmark Redefined

Early access to the Sony FE 100mm f/2.8 Macro GM allowed a professional reviewer to put the lens through its paces in a studio environment, directly comparing its performance against established high-end systems. The reviewer, known for a critical and often skeptical approach to new gear, expressed profound astonishment at the lens’s capabilities. For years, their go-to setup for demanding macro work involved the Fujifilm GFX 100s medium format camera paired with the Fujifilm GF 120mm f/4 Macro lens. This medium-format combination is celebrated for its exceptional image quality and resolution, making it a formidable benchmark.
However, when the Sony FE 100mm f/2.8 GM was mounted on a Sony a7R V, the results were unequivocal. The Sony system not only focused significantly faster but also produced demonstrably sharper images, all while delivering a superior magnification level. This outcome is particularly remarkable given that the Fujifilm GFX 100s system, with its larger sensor and higher megapixel count, generally offers a resolution advantage. The reviewer’s finding that the full-frame Sony setup, especially with the 2x teleconverter, surpassed the medium-format kit in key macro performance areas—sharpness, autofocus speed, and magnification—highlights the truly groundbreaking nature of the new Sony lens. The comparison images provided illustrate this point vividly, with the Sony system exhibiting remarkable detail and clarity in its 100% crops, even against the high-resolution Fujifilm medium format output.

Competitive Analysis: A New Leader Emerges
The introduction of the Sony FE 100mm f/2.8 Macro GM inevitably invites comparison with its closest rivals in the premium macro lens market. The following table provides a snapshot of its standing against key competitors:

| Feature | Sony FE 100mm f/2.8 GM | Fujifilm GF 120mm f/4 | Canon EF 100mm f/2.8L IS | Canon RF 100mm f/2.8L IS |
|---|---|---|---|---|
| Lens Design | 17 Elements in 13 Groups | 14 Elements in 9 Groups | 15 Elements in 12 Groups | 17 Elements in 13 Groups |
| Stabilization | Yes, five-stop | Yes, five-stop | Yes, two-stop | Yes, five-stop |
| Magnification Level | 1.4x Magnification | 0.5x Magnification | 1x Magnification | 1.4x Magnification |
| Minimum Focus Distance | 0.26m | 0.45m | 0.30m | 0.26m |
| Size Dimensions (Diameter x Length) | 81.4 x 147.6 mm | 89.2 x 152.5 mm | 77.7 x 123 mm | 81.5 x 148 mm |
| Weight | 646 g | 980 g | 625 g | 730 g |
| Price (Approx. USD) | $1399 – $1,699 (TBD) | $3,099 | $1,399 | $1,199 |
Analyzing this comparison reveals the Sony FE 100mm f/2.8 GM’s compelling position. While the Fujifilm GF 120mm f/4 Macro operates on a medium format system with inherent sensor advantages, its 0.5x magnification is significantly lower than Sony’s 1.4x (or 2.8x with teleconverter), and its price point is considerably higher. The Canon EF 100mm f/2.8L IS, an older DSLR design, offers only 1x magnification and two-stop stabilization, placing it at a disadvantage. The Canon RF 100mm f/2.8L IS, a more direct mirrorless competitor, matches Sony’s 1.4x magnification and five-stop stabilization. However, Sony’s use of four XD linear motors likely gives it an edge in autofocus speed, and its compatibility with the 2x teleconverter for 2.8x magnification provides a unique and powerful advantage that no other mainstream macro lens currently offers. Furthermore, the Sony lens manages to achieve its advanced features while maintaining a competitive weight and size.
The anticipated price range of $1,399 – $1,699 positions the Sony FE 100mm f/2.8 Macro GM competitively within the premium macro lens segment, especially considering its cutting-edge features and G Master designation. This makes it an attractive proposition for both professional and enthusiast photographers looking for a top-tier macro solution without the significantly higher investment required for medium format systems.
